Advancing Healthcare with Innovative Peptide Solutions

The biotechnology industry is constantly seeking new ways to improve patient care. Peptides, small chains of amino acids, are emerging as a promising tool in this endeavor. These substances possess a special ability to bind with specific organs in the body, making them ideal for addressing a broad range of conditions.

Moreover, peptides offer several benefits over traditional therapies. They are generally safe and have a minimal risk of complications. Their ability to activate specific cellular pathways opens up new avenues for developing targeted and potent treatments.

  • Scientists are actively exploring the therapeutic potential of peptides in areas such as infectious diseases.
  • Innovative peptide-based therapies have shown positive results in clinical studies.
  • Continued research is expected to result even more advanced peptide solutions for a variety of health challenges.
